Is your Land Rover LR3's car alarm mysteriously going off in the middle of the night?
Watch Doug, our Land Rover Master Technician, as he replaces the likely culprit, the faulty alarm switch in the hood latch assembly of your 2005-2009 Land Rover LR3.
Using LR173841G (old part # LR138826G), which includes the entire latching fixture with the alarm switch.
The switch itself is no longer in stock, so we advise you replace the entire hood latch assembly that includes the new switch already installed.
Part number LR138826G has been superseded from LR065340G.

This parts replacement is also valid on the Range Rover Sport '06-'09.
Please refer to video addressing LR041431OEM if installing just the alarm switch component ( part # LR041431OEM ) into existing latch assembly.
